- Title
OCCUPATIONAL HEALTH HAZARDS FACING MORTUARY ATTENDANTS.
- Authors
Mittal, S.
- Abstract
The mortuary is the most neglected and ignored place in almost all the hospitals. It is not having even basic facilities for the departed souls, public and officials working there. The risk of working in a mortuary is enormous; Cadavers pose the risk of infection like tuberculosis, HIV, Hepatitis B and C viruses to mortuary attendants. High risk of psychological stress among mortuary attendants, leading or contributing manifestations such as alcoholism and substance abuse is present. It is suggested that the staff should be educated on the risks involved in their work and on the preventive measures they could employ to minimize them. Measures like stress management, vaccination, improved mortuary hygiene and use of personal protective equipment (PPE) need to be instituted as a matter of urgency.
